Understanding Your Procharger System

Before diving into upgrades, it’s essential to understand how your Procharger system works. The Procharger is a centrifugal supercharger that increases the amount of air entering the engine, allowing for more fuel to be burned and, consequently, more power to be produced. However, this process generates heat, which can lead to performance issues if not managed properly.

Importance of Cooling in High-Performance Applications

When pushing your engine to 800+ horsepower, the importance of cooling cannot be overstated. High temperatures can lead to engine knock, reduced power output, and even catastrophic failure. Therefore, upgrading your cooling system is critical to maintaining reliability and performance.

Key Components of a Cooling System

  • Intercooler: An upgraded intercooler can significantly reduce intake temperatures, improving air density and performance.
  • Radiator: A high-performance radiator can improve coolant flow and heat dissipation.
  • Cooling Fans: Upgrading to high-flow electric fans can enhance airflow and cooling efficiency.

Upgrading Your Procharger System

When upgrading your Procharger system, consider the following components to enhance cooling and reliability:

Intercooler Upgrades

Investing in a larger or more efficient intercooler can dramatically lower the temperature of the air entering your engine. Look for options with a higher core volume and better airflow characteristics.

Fuel System Enhancements

To support increased power levels, upgrading your fuel system is crucial. Consider larger injectors and a high-flow fuel pump to ensure that your engine receives the necessary fuel at higher power outputs.

Upgraded Oil System

Maintaining optimal oil temperature is vital for engine reliability. Consider adding an oil cooler or upgrading your oil pump to ensure proper lubrication under high-stress conditions.
